How to fill out estate analysis questionnaire of

Illustration

How to fill out estate analysis questionnaire of

01
First, gather all necessary documents such as property deeds, wills, and financial statements.
02
Begin by providing personal information including name, address, and contact details.
03
Answer questions regarding your marital status and if you have any children.
04
Provide detailed information about your assets including real estate, investments, and bank accounts.
05
Answer questions about your liabilities, including any outstanding debts or loans.
06
Include information about any insurance policies or retirement accounts you have.
07
Answer questions about your preferences for distributing your estate, including beneficiaries and any specific instructions.
08
Lastly, review and double-check your responses before submitting the questionnaire.

The estate analysis questionnaire is a document that gathers information about an individual's estate assets, liabilities, beneficiaries, and other important details.
Anyone who has a responsibility for managing an estate or trust is required to file the estate analysis questionnaire.
The estate analysis questionnaire can be filled out by providing accurate information about the assets, debts, beneficiaries, and other relevant details of the estate.
The purpose of the estate analysis questionnaire is to provide a comprehensive overview of an individual's estate to ensure proper distribution and management of assets.
Information such as assets, debts, beneficiaries, estate planning documents, and any other relevant details must be reported on the estate analysis questionnaire.
